Format details

VSD is the legacy binary format of Microsoft Visio (pre-2013), used for flowcharts, network diagrams and org charts. It was superseded by the XML-based VSDX.

OGG (Vorbis) is an open, royalty-free audio format delivering good quality at small sizes — popular for games and the web.
